Javascript本身功能仍旧比较单一,所以在nodejs中提供了额外的工具库,叫做util库,其中包含很多常用的功能,下面我们一次来看一下具体的使用方法:
使用util过程中,我们需要引入:
const util = require('util');
util.format(format[, …])
这个方法主要用来格式化字符串, 第一个参数为想要格式化的语法形式,其余几个为参数。
- %s –匹配字符串类型
- %d – 匹配数字类型
- %j —匹配格式成JSON类型
- %%– 格式成%
如果指定的格式类型没有匹配到相应的参数,将不会被替换掉,比如:
util.format('%s:%s', 'foo'); // 'foo:%s'
如果添加的参数多余匹配类型,会自动拼接值格式化后的字符串,并以空格隔开, 比如: